How do you change the belt on a tensioner pulley?
How do you change the belt on a tensioner pulley?
Slide the belt off the tensioner pulley with your hand or a screwdriver. Let the tensioner pulley carefully pivot back into position. Remove the belt from the rest of the pulleys and the engine compartment. Compare the new belt to the old one. The new belt might be slightly shorter but the configuration should be the same.
Which is better Ford Windstar V-belt or serpentine belt?
The serpentine belt on the Ford Windstar has a better construction and tends to last longer than traditional V-belts. Unfortunately, newer belts normally wear out from the inside out, showing no signs of belt weakening.
Where to disconnect ground battery cable on Windstar?
Park your Windstar in a safe place and open the hood. Disconnect the ground (black) battery cable using a wrench. This will prevent the cooling fan from activating if you recently drove your vehicle or someone from cranking the engine by accident while you are trying to remove the belt.
What’s the best way to release tension on a belt?
Pivot the tensioner pulley clockwise or away from the belt to release the belt tension, keeping your fingers away from between the belt and the pulleys at all times. Slide the belt off the tensioner pulley with your hand or a screwdriver. Let the tensioner pulley carefully pivot back into position.

What happens when a belt tensioner is loose?
If the tensioner is loose the belts may squeak or squeal, especially when the engine is first started. It is also possible for the tensioner pulley or bearing to wear out, in which case the vehicle will produce a grinding noise from the pulley. 2. Unusual belt wear
Why do you need tensioner on serpentine belts?
Both are used to keep tension on the engine serpentine belts so that they can drive the various engine accessories. When the tensioner has an issue, it can affect the how the belts drive the pulleys which can affect the performance and functionality of the vehicle.
